  2. Hello,

    I have this weird problem with 1992 LS400.

    Car starts fine every time in the morning or whenever it was stopped for longer periods (few hours). But sometimes, after driving a while for it to warm up to normal level, if stopped and attempted to start it again right away (in a minute or so) car would crank but engine wouldn't start. However, after waiting few minutes (4-5 minutes) it will start again just fine as always. Feels like something inside has to cool down to start again. Battery is fine, starter is fine, temperature gauge on dashboard never comes above the middle. This phenomenon however does not appear consistently because I am testing it now and then. For instance, I would park at the office parking lot when arriving in the morning, stop a car and then try to start it again. One day it would start just fine and the other would not. I leave it there, come back to drive for lunch and starts just fine as always.

    I realize this could be caused by hundreds of problems but wondering perhaps somebody is or were experiencing something similar and would share it with me.
